FSDB hosting job fair

FSDB Job Fair The Florida School for the Deaf and the Blind (FSDB) will host a job fair to recruit talent for all departments and positions on Saturday, September 17th, from 9 a.m. – 12 p.m. The event will be on the FSDB campus in historic St. Augustine and is open to the public. Join us to learn about employment opportunities in: ·     Academics – Teachers, Instructional Assistants, Para Professionals ·     Boarding Services – Residential Instructors ·     Facilities – Housekeepers, Carpenters, Groundskeepers · Transportation – Bus Drivers, Chaperones, Mechanics FSDB is a state of Florida agency and a major employer in St. Johns…

VIDEO: Fire alarms sound after Flagler College evacuated due to nearby suspicious activity

UPDATE 4:49p: Police have cleared the library, caution tape has been lifted, and students are returning to the area after K-9 units cleared the library. No arrests have been made, no suspects wanted. UPDATE: Police say they saw suspicious activity on surveillance video of the area. They are in the process of determining if there is an accelerant present. There is no timeline yet on when the scene may be cleared. There is no word on whether or not this is related to the recent incident at the Pirate and Treasure museum, as this investigation is ongoing. St. Augustine police…
